Contents: Preface 1- Introduction 2- Salient Features of Marital Status 3- Age at Marriage- mean, median and singulate 4- Age at Marriage by religion and level of education 5- Marital Status and age at marriage among Scheduled Castes Tables

Abstract: This report, *“Marital Status and Age at Marriage – An Analysis of 2001 Census Data,”* analyzes marital patterns and age at marriage in India using 2001 Census data. It examines variations by gender, religion, education, and Scheduled Castes, focusing on mean, median, and singulate ages at marriage. The study highlights demographic trends, regional differences, and the influence of socio-economic and cultural factors on marital behavior. It also traces changes in marriage patterns over time, reflecting evolving social norms and their implications for population structure, gender relations, and policy planning in India’s socio-demographic landscape.
